"I am Brenda Marie Yeager. I am the poet laureate of Lake County," Yeager said, and invited community members to attend a featured reading called The Shared World and to participate in a robust open mic following the event.

Yeager introduced Georgina Marie Guardado, a former Lake County poet laureate, who read two poems for the board: "Don't Go Into the Library," by Arizona poet Alberto Rios, and a poem by Lake County poet Vicente Zeta Colosian, whose work is being displayed in poetry boxes around the county for the month of April.

Guardado noted that the Colosian poems are on public display and read a poem selected at the Board's request. She also urged attendees to support the library and community resources, saying libraries are "the book of books" and warning they can change a person who goes inside.

Guardado also made a brief appeal related to an animal in need: "Please consider adopting Wheezy. That poor girl is at risk for euthanasia," she said.

Yeager framed the month-long celebration as part of efforts to support local poets and library programming in Lake County. She said the weekend reading at Lakeport Library will feature Lake County poets reading their own work and invited residents to participate.

The meeting record shows Yeager and Guardado spoke during the agenda item labeled National Poetry Month Poem of the Week; no formal vote or ordinance was recorded on the item in the transcript.

The county-wide poetry displays, the Saturday reading at Lakeport Library and the showing of Vicente Zeta Colosian's poems aim to increase visibility for local poets and library programs through April.
